Charles Morgan

Executive Chairman

    Charles D. Morgan is the executive Chairman of the Board of First Orion Corp., a private company that developed and markets PrivacyStar, an application that helps protect the mobile phone users’ privacy. He is also an equity owner of Bridgehampton Capital Management LLC, for which he also serves as Chairman of its Advisory Board and co-manager of investments.

    Mr. Morgan is on the board of INUVO, Inc., a public company focused on simplifying performance-based advertising, and Entrust, Inc., a private company that provides solutions to protect digital identities and information for security-conscious enterprises and governments.

    Mr. Morgan is also Chairman of the Board of Querencia, a private golf development and golf course in Cabo San Lucas, Mexico.

    Mr. Morgan has extensive experience managing and investing in private and public companies, including Acxiom Corporation, an information services company he helped grow from an early-stage company to an international corporation that generated $1.4 billion in annual revenue during his tenure as CEO from 1972 to 2008. Mr. Morgan served as the Chairman of Acxiom’s Board for 30 years and also held various leadership roles with the Direct Marketing Association (DMA), including Chairman of the Board.

    Jeff Stalnaker

    President, CEO, & Co-Founder

      Prior to PrivacyStar, Jeff held the position of Division President of the financial services division at Acxiom (NASDAQ: ACXM), a leading provider of integrated marketing services to the global 1000. The financial services division is the largest industry for Acxiom, generating revenue of $420 million annually and consisting of over 1,000 associates. In 2001, Jeff was appointed Acxiom’s Chief Financial Officer and prior to that appointment, he served in a variety of financial/accounting positions throughout the company leading acquisitions valued in excess of $800 million.

      Prior to joining Acxiom, Jeff was a senior analyst with the Arkansas Public Service Commission, responsible for recommendations and testifying before the Commission on a variety of Federal and State public utility issues, including the telecommunications industry. He completed the National Association of Regulatory Utility Commissioners (NARUC) Regulatory Studies Program at Michigan State University. He also was an accountant with a regional public accounting firm in Little Rock, Arkansas.

      Jeff received a Bachelor’s Degree in Accounting from the University of Central Arkansas and is a member of the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ants and the Arkansas Society of Certified Public Accountants.

        Jim Womble

        Senior Business Development Leader

          Jim is our senior business development leader and is responsible for developing carrier and partner relationships, helping to extend the reach of our many features.

          Jim was a senior executive with Acxiom (NASDAQ: ACXM), a leading provider of integrated marketing services to the global 1000. During his 34-year career he served in many capacities including client services leader, where he led relationships with Acxiom clients in major industries including financial services, health and government and global development leader where he oversaw global strategy development, including partnerships and merger and acquisition activity. Jim was a member of the Acxiom board of directors from 1975 to 2005.

          Prior to Acxiom, Jim worked for IBM from 1966 until 1974, as a systems engineer and marketing representative.

          Jim received his Bachelor of Science degree in Civil Engineering from the University of Arkansas.

                  Scott Hambuchen

                  Business Development Leader

                    Scott is responsible for the international expansion of PrivacyStar through our relationship with Syniverse. He leads the research and analysis related to the specific regions where PrivacyStar is needed and may be deployed. He also provides leadership and direction to the development of international PrivacyStar features in various geographies.

                    Prior to joining PrivacyStar, Scott was President of Gryphon Networks, a leading provider of telecommunication products and services. Under his stewardship, the company expanded its core focus to include business-building contact strategies in addition to multichannel contact governance. Scott was instrumental in helping carrier clients realize the value of leveraging consumer preference to enhance lifetime value, increase marketing productivity and drive business revenue.

                    Prior to joining Gryphon in 2009, Scott enjoyed an 18-year career at Acxiom where he served as a senior executive and sat on the company leadership team, overseeing core Acxiom capabilities including Customer Data Integration, Packaged Marketing Database Services and Enterprise Marketing Services. During his tenure, Scott was appointed managing director of Acxiom’s $100 million European operation living in London for several years. He also served a group leader for industries including insurance, telecommunications and retail comprising over $50 million in annual revenue.

                    Scott holds a degree in industrial engineering from the University of Arkansas.
